#d4f869 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d4f869 is composed of 83.1% red, 97.3%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 57.7%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 75.1 degrees, a saturation of 91.1% and a lightness of 69.2%. #d4f869 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d2 with #a9f100. Closest websafe color is: #ccff66.

#d4f869 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d4f869 has RGB values of R:212, G:248,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0.15, M:0, Y:0.58,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 13957225.
